Why These Are the Top BMW Repair Auto Repair Shops in Margie

The BMW repair market serving Margie, Minnesota, is characterized by low density but high specialization. Due to the rural nature of Northern Minnesota, owners of complex vehicles like BMWs are dependent on a small number of highly skilled independent shops. There are no dealerships for hundreds of miles, making these independent specialists critically important. **Average Quality:** The quality of the top-tier shops is exceptionally high. They survive and thrive by offering dealership-level expertise, often with more personalized service, at a more competitive labor rate. They invest in ongoing training and specialized tools to keep up with BMW technology. **Competition Level:** Competition is low in terms of the number of providers, but intense in terms of technical competency. A shop cannot be a "general mechanic" and successfully service modern BMWs. The shops listed have built their reputations over decades by consistently solving problems that other local garages cannot.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ing is premium but below dealership rates. Labor rates typically range from $130-$165/hour. Given the specialized parts and diagnostic time required, customers should expect a higher cost of ownership compared to domestic or Asian brands, but these specialists provide significant value by accurately diagnosing issues and using quality parts, preventing costly repeat repairs.
